This is not a perfect analysis, but: - Roku has 487M in SVB - After the 8-K released, Roku lost 323M in market cap Basically, the market is expecting around 30c of value recouped for every dollar inside of SVB. (note: I know this analysis isn't perfect, but it gives a rough idea)
